Display Friend count in Posbit
 
One of our members asked for this so I figured I would do a quick share here.

Go to AdminCP> Styles & Templates> Postbit Legacy.

Find:
Code:

<div>$post[icqicon] $post[aimicon] $post[msnicon] $post[yahooicon] $post[skypeicon]</div>
            </div>

Below that add:

Code:

<if condition="$post['userid']"><div>Friends: (<b><a href="member.php?u=$post[userid]">$post[friendcount]</a></b>)</div></if>
Thats it. Easy breezy. If you use itrader or an award mod, you can place it below the code for that as I have done.

Very nice, thank you. I placed it a little differently, in postbit. not postbit legacy.

Code:

<if condition="$show['reputation']"><if condition="$show['reppower']">$vbphrase[reppower]: <span id="reppower_$post[postid]_$post[userid]">$post[reppower]</span> </if><div><span id="repdisplay_$post[postid]_$post[userid]">$post[reputationdisplay]</span></div></if>
And placed above it.

Code:

<if condition="$post['userid']"><div>Friends: (<b><a href="member.php?u=$post[userid]">$post[friendcount]</a></b>)</div></if>
Nice location for me. Again, THANK YOU!
